We are looking for MRI Radiographers to join us at our Melbourne clinic located at 505 Toorak Road Toorak Melbourne VIC. The MRI Radiographer is responsible for operating cutting‑edge MRI equipment to provide high‑quality imaging services for diagnostic and preventative purposes. This position requires technical expertise a strong commitment to patient care and adherence to regulatory standards specific to Australias healthcare system. This is a casual position working hours will be scheduled on an as‑needed basis primarily to provide coverage when team members are away. Our clinic operating hours are Monday to Friday 7:45 AM 3:45 PM AEST though hours may vary depending on location demand and business needs. Help reshape the world through proactive healthcare while working with cutting‑edge technology and high performing teams with deep expertise – join us to make a difference in peoples lives What You’ll Do MRI Operations: Perform MRI scans in accordance with clinical protocols and imaging standards. Ensure proper patient positioning safety and comfort during procedures. Operate and maintain advanced imaging equipment ensuring optimal performance. Patient Care: Educate patients about the MRI procedure addressing any concerns or questions. Monitor patients during scans to ensure their well‑being and safety. Data Management: Accurately capture and store imaging data adhering to data protection and confidentiality standards. Collaborate with radiologists and healthcare professionals to deliver accurate diagnostic results. Regulatory Compliance: Ensure compliance with Australian healthcare and radiation safety regulations. Participate in regular equipment testing and quality assurance programs. Team Collaboration: Work closely with clinical and administrative teams to ensure seamless operations. Participate in ongoing training and professional development to stay updated on imaging advancements. What You’ll Bring Education and Certification Bachelors or Diploma in Medical Imaging Radiography or a related field. Registration with the Australian Health Practitioner Regulation Agency (AHPRA) or equivalent certification. Certification in MRI technology (preferred but not mandatory if experience is demonstrated). Experience Minimum of 2 years of experience as an MRI technologist preferably in a diagnostic or preventative imaging setting. Experience operating advanced MRI systems (experience with Philips equipment is an advantage). Skills Strong technical skills with the ability to troubleshoot and resolve equipment issues. Excellent patient care and communication skills. Attention to detail and ability to work in a fast‑paced clinical environment. Knowledge of Australian healthcare compliance standards accreditation and safety regulations.
